Abstract
The utility model relates to the technical field of denim fabric, in particular to a spandex fabric denim fabric structure, which is formed by interweaving warp yarns and weft yarns, wherein the warp yarns are formed by core threads and a covering layer covered outside the core threads, the weft yarns are formed by core threads and a covering layer covered outside the core threads. Because of the spandex fabric denim fabric structure is formed by interweaving the warp yarns and the weft yarns, in addition, the warp yarns and the weft yarns are respectively formed by the core threads and the covering layers covered outside the core threads, the spandex fabric denim fabric structure has the characteristics that the comfort elasticity is realized, the cloth surface is smooth, the elastic rebounding performance is good, the product grade is high, the hand feeling is soft, the texture is soft and smooth, and the like.

Background technology
Distinctive elasticity of stockinette and drapability make that it is comfortable and easy to wear, sense of touch is plentiful, are subjected to liking of consumer deeply.Woven elastic force jean on the market mainly is a latitude bullet jean at present, less through playing jean, its main cause be through elastic fabric to the requirement of process technology, process equipment all apparently higher than the latitude elastic fabric, making becomes one of difficult point that present fabric produces through elastic fabric.Yet, angle from the mechanics comfortableness, human body longitudinal stretching power and stretch range be all apparently higher than laterally when movable, and with even more important, therefore exploitation four sides bullet (cartographic bi-bomb) jean is the direction of cowboy's elastic force new product development to the warp-wise elasticity of fabric to the mechanics comfortableness of human body.

The specific embodiment
Below in conjunction with accompanying drawing the utility model is further described.
As shown in Figure 1, a kind of four sides described in the utility model bullet jean structure, it is interweaved by warp thread 1 and weft yarn 2 and forms, 1 bottom right twill-weave braiding in warp thread 1 of the present utility model and the weft yarn 2 main employings 2, and the tightness between the described warp thread 1 is 80.5-88.5%, tightness between the described weft yarn 2 is 50.5-65.1%, and total tightness degree is 85.5%-95.5%, is 200-400g/m to guarantee weight of the present utility model
2
Wherein, described warp thread 1 is made up of heart yearn 3 and the clads 4 that are coated on outside the heart yearn 3; Described weft yarn 2 is made up of heart yearn 3 and the clads 4 that are coated on outside the heart yearn 3.
What need further specify is that described heart yearn 3 can be polyester thread, polyamide fibre line, spandex line or filamental thread; The preferred described heart yearn 3 of the utility model is the T-400 filamental thread, described T-400 filamental thread is to be formed by two kinds of different polyester fiber PET and PTT composite spinning arranged side by side, the shrinkage factor difference of two kinds of polyester fibers, solid with spring-like is curled, and this being crimped onto after Overheating Treatment still exists.The fabric that is made into has that excellent elasticity is restorative, DIMENSIONAL STABILITY, flexibility, dyeability, and in the process than being easier to control, the arrangement of dyeing back is simple, cost is low.The concrete specification of filamental thread is 30-150dtex/36f; Certainly, the utility model is not to get rid of being suitable for of other gauge fiber line.Described clad 4 is cotton yarn layer, spun rayon yarn's layer, polyester-cotton blend layer or cotton layer; The preferred described clad 4 of the utility model is the cotton layer of 8-36tex.
Concrete production technology is: warp thread: winder → warping → dye and starch → pass; Warp thread+weft yarn: weave → arrangement → finished product inspection of base inspection → back; Back arrangement: grey cloth turns over and stitches → singes → destarch → mercerising → tentering setting → preshrunk.
